Yes, duct tape method works to help get a grip on the bulbs. Since the footwell bulbs cannot be turned off and they do heat up quickly, a pair of rubber gloves may help when removing the hot factory bulbs (tiny).
Yup - Duct Tape works good - turn the lights off with the interior light control left of the steering wheel (up and down arrows) and no melting the duct tape.
